    Trusts Lawyers in Celina, TX

    Trusts and estates attorneys draft and administer trusts and create wills, and other estate planning documents. They create revocable and irrevocable trusts, advise on trustee selection, handle trust administration and accounting, resolve beneficiary disputes, assist with probate filing and administration, and ensure assets are distributed according to clients’ wishes with tax efficiency.
